===== WEEKEND RECAP FOR MAY 29th – JUNE 1st, 2026 =====

Paul Craighead has been dominating the Monster X Tour this spring and has raced in 17 consecutive final rounds. He swept all three events in Show Low this weekend and is now knocking on the door of the Top 50.

 

Mike Christensen gained 5 spots in the rankings (the biggest improvement this weekend) after winning a wild muddy race in Montana against fellow Throttle Monsters, including his first ever head-to-head match-up with daughter Bam.

 

Jon Zimmer Jr won the Throwdown racing in Wilmot and now leads the world in Total Points with 11,443, passing up Blake Granger. That bump puts Zimmer in a tie for 2nd place with Tyler Menninga (who gets the spot based on our first tie-breaker which is Average Points). Zimmer has a shot at the #1 rank, but he’ll either need to increase his Average Points by a lot or hope that other drivers can pass Menninga and defending Open Champion Coty Saucier in Total Points.

 

Last weekend also saw exciting holeshot racing in Canada where Mat Briand flew past Richard Bernier to win on the Monster Madness tour. In Quebec, Mikey Vaters beat out Pat Paquet on a tricky concrete roundy-race course. Full Throttle had two drag races in two cities with Roger Gauger getting a win and runner-up finish. The Renegade Tour had two drag races in one city, with Chuckie Pauken getting a win and runner-up. Plus more mud in Bozeman for the MOD Tour, the final leg of the Big Three in Australia where Brock Thomas and Jack Monkhouse split wins, and Kreg Christensen taking two different trucks to the finals in C’oeur d’Alene.

 

This weekend coming up has some big events in store as the annual Miami, Oklahoma battle is all set up, and the Swedish big trucks are back on track for the opening round of Monsterrace 2026!

===== BEREA, OH =====

5/30 Sat Aft: CHARLIE PAUKEN III [The Haymaker] defeated RJ Turner [War Wizard]

5/30 Sat Ngt: PRESTON PÉREZ [Velociraptor] defeated Charlie Pauken III [The Haymaker]

 

The Renegade tour was rocking in Berea with exciting two jump drag racing. Charlie Pauken III took The Haymaker into the final round both events and gained 3 spots in the rankings to join the Top 50. His toughest race in the afternoon was a narrow victory over Preston Collins in the semi-finals which saw the trucks get together in the shutdown area. In the evening, Preston Perez pushed his Velociraptor truck to the limit to score his 4th win of the season.

 

===== BOZEMAN, MT =====

5/29 Fri Ngt: ERIC SWANSON [Obsessed] defeated Tyler Groth [The Veteran]

5/30 Sat Ngt: We do not have results from this event

5/31 Sun Aft: TYLER GROTH [The Veteran] defeated Travis Groth [Monster Moose]

 

It was a muddy weekend in Bozeman for the Monsters of Destruction tour. Eric Swanson won on Friday night over Tyler Groth. Swanson was knocked out on Sunday by breakage, as was his teammate Pretty Obsessed, which let fast qualifier Tyler Groth return to the bracket and pick up the win. We also know that Aaron Basl in Night Life won the Saturday night race, but we do not yet know the rest of the bracket, so points cannot be awarded.

===== BURNSIDE, KY =====

5/30 Sat Ngt: DALTON VANSKYOCK [Stomper] defeated Roger Gauger [County Mounty]

 

The Full Throttle Tour started their two city weekend with drag racing in Burnside, Kentucky. Dalton VanSkyock was dominate all night and picked up the racing win over Roger Gauger, giving him his first racing win of the season.

 

===== CAMPBELLSVILLE, KY =====

6/1 Mon Ngt: ROGER GAUGER [County Mounty] defeated Colton Kiser [American Scout]

 

After their race in Burnside, the Full Throttle team moved to Campbellsville for a rare Monday night race. In Burnside, American Scout missed racing with breakage while Stomper raced into the finals. In Campbellsville, that luck was reversed as Stomper broke during his first round bye run and it was American Scout using the fast-loser position to return and set-up a rematch with Roger Gauger in the finals. The results were the same, however, as Gauger powered past the Scout for his first win of the season.

 

===== C'OEUR D'ALENE, ID =====

5/29 Fri Ngt: KREG CHRISTENSEN [Dragon Slayer] defeated David Tucker [Next Level]

5/30 Sat Ngt: TIM MANCHESTER [Hillbilly] defeated Kreg Christensen [Farmageddon]

 

Veteran Kreg Christensen advanced to the finals twice with the Insanity Tour in Idaho and he did it in two different trucks, as he and fellow veteran Corey Clark switched rides for the Saturday night race. Tim Manchester in Hillbilly was the only one able to get past Christensen this weekend when he beat him in the Saturday night finals to level their season series at 1 race a piece.

===== LEWISTOWN, MT =====

5/30 Sat Aft: CARSON WILLIAMS [Velociraptor] defeated Dalton Widner [Shell Shock'ed]

5/30 Sat Ngt: MIKEAL CHRISTENSEN [Vendetta] defeated Tim Hall Jr [Jurassic Attack]

 

The highest rated event of the weekend (1.058) was the Team Throttle Monster challenge in Montana. Carson Williams won the afternoon race over Dalton Widner in the first meeting of the two teammates. For Williams it was his 4th win of the season and gained him 2 spots in the rankings.

 

In the evening, heavy rains turn the St Louis-style track into a mud bath, but the expert drivers from the largest independent team in the sport weren’t slowed down one bit even with the slick conditions. Tim Hall Jr had two chances against Dalton Widner and won the one that counted to advance to the final round. There he met with team patriarch Mike Christensen who had beat out daughter Bam Christensen in the semi-finals in their first ever head-to-head race. Mike was a master of the mud and slung Vendetta into the turns to keep ahead of Hall and pick up his 2nd win of the season. That moved him up 5 spots in the rankings, which was the largest improvement this weekend.

===== PORTAGE, WI =====

5/30 Sat Aft: ROD SCHMIDT [Redneck Rampage] defeated Byron Cadigan [Talkin' Dirty]

 

We’ve seen Byron Cadigan in the final round plenty of times before, but with the Monster X Tour in Portage we saw him make the finals in the home-built Talkin’ Dirty truck after an unexpected upset over Wicked Sickness in the first round. Despite a close final round battle into the turn of the J-hook race, Rod Schmidt’s Redneck Rampage was too powerful and pulled away over the final two jumps to take the win.

 

===== QUEBEC, QC =====

5/30 Sat Aft: MICHAEL VATERS II [Overkill Evolution] defeated Pat Paquet [Psycho Pat]

 

The Monster Spectacular crew had another huge crowd in Quebec for reverse concrete Chicago-style racing. The no-ramp cars and slick turns made for a challenging track this year. Both Psycho Pat and Suberfoot spun out in their early round match-up, but Pat Paquet recovered the quickest to pick up the win. In the finals, Michael Vaters II in Overkill Evolution stayed calm through the turns and fast over the cars to pick up his 6th win of the season.

===== WILMOT, WI =====

5/30 Sat Aft: JON ZIMMER JR [Terminal Velocity] defeated Jon Zimmer Sr [Uproar]

 

Last but not least was Throwdown in Wilmot for fast paced Chicago-style racing. Father and son Jon Zimmer met in the finals with Jon Jr taking the win. He is 17-5 against his dad this season and now leads the world with 11,443 points! Zimmer has a chance at reaching the #1 ranking, either the hard way (by winning some big events and increasing his Average Points) or the other hard way (hoping that drivers like Alex Bardin, Bill Payne, and Triton and Montana Robbins can get ahead of Coty Saucier and Tyler Menninga in Total Points).
